VPS 150芯动版,安全配置与优化方案
卡尔云官网
www.kaeryun.com
在当今数字化时代,VPS(虚拟专用服务器)已经成为企业级服务器的重要组成部分,广泛应用于Web开发、电子商务、社交媒体平台等场景,随着技术的不断进步,VPS服务器也面临着各种安全威胁和漏洞,例如SQL注入、XSS攻击、DDoS攻击等,为了确保服务器的安全性,合理配置和优化安全措施至关重要,本文将围绕VPS 150芯动版,探讨其安全配置和优化方案。
安全配置的重要性
VPS 150芯动版作为高性能的VPS服务器,具备强大的处理能力和快速的响应速度,但这也意味着其安全性必须得到充分重视,一个安全的VPS服务器不仅可以保护企业数据免受攻击,还可以提升用户体验,避免潜在的经济损失。
操作系统版本
选择一个稳定且安全的操作系统版本至关重要,VPS 150芯动版通常预装了Linux操作系统,建议选择最新的版本,例如Ubuntu 22.04 LTS或Fedora 37,这些版本的Linux系统通常具有较高的安全性和稳定性,能够有效防范已知的安全漏洞。
软件包选择
在VPS 150芯动版中,软件包的安装和配置直接影响服务器的安全性,建议在安装完成后,启用必要的软件包,
- Apache/ Nginx:这些Web服务器软件包能够提供高效的Web处理能力,并且具有内置的安全漏洞修复机制。
- SSL证书:启用SSL证书可以保护敏感数据传输的安全性,防止未授权的窃取。
- 防火墙:配置防火墙规则,允许必要的端口连接,同时阻止不必要的流量。
防火墙设置
防火墙是服务器安全的第一道防线,在VPS 150芯动版中,可以使用iptables
或firewalld
来配置防火墙,建议将防火墙设置为最小化,仅允许必要的服务和端口连接,
- 免费端口:80(HTTP)、443(HTTPS)、22(SSH)、21(SSH远程登录)
- 其他端口:根据服务器需求,允许必要的应用服务。
安全头
安全头是防止DDoS攻击和网络扫描的有效工具,在VPS 150芯动版中,可以使用nmap
或netcat
等工具进行安全头配置,限制扫描的范围和频率,确保网络的安全性。
常见漏洞和攻击
了解常见的漏洞和攻击方式,可以帮助我们更好地配置安全措施。
SQL注入和XSS攻击
SQL注入和XSS(Cross-Site Scripting)攻击是Web应用中最常见的安全漏洞之一,为了避免这些攻击,可以采取以下措施:
- 输入验证:对用户输入进行严格的格式验证,避免注入恶意代码。
- 输出过滤:对敏感数据进行加密或隐藏,防止被注入到页面中。
- 框架安全:使用经过签名的Web框架,例如
Symfony
或Django
,可以有效防止SQL注入攻击。
DDoS攻击
DDoS(分布式拒绝服务)攻击是一种通过 overwhelming服务器流量来破坏服务的攻击方式,为了防范DDoS攻击,可以采取以下措施:
- 流量监控:使用
Wireshark
或tcpdump
等工具监控网络流量,及时发现异常流量。 - 流量限制:配置
iptables
或firewalld
,限制单个用户的登录流量,防止攻击者滥用资源。 - 负载均衡:使用
Nginx
或Apache
的负载均衡功能,确保资源被合理分配。
其他安全威胁
除了SQL注入和DDoS攻击,VPS服务器还可能面临以下安全威胁:
- 病毒和木马:定期进行病毒扫描,使用杀毒软件(如
Kaspersky
或Avast
)对系统进行检查。 - Man-in-the-Middle( MitM)攻击:使用
man 0
或man 8
进行嗅探,确保通信的安全性。 - 密码管理:避免使用弱密码,定期更换密码,并使用密码哈希存储。
优化建议
为了进一步提升VPS 150芯动版的安全性,可以采取以下优化措施:
定期更新
软件包和系统内核的定期更新是确保服务器安全的关键,建议在每次登录后,使用apt update
或dnf update
更新软件包,并安装最新的安全补丁。
使用安全的Web框架
选择经过签名的Web框架,可以有效防止常见的安全漏洞,使用Django
或Symfony
,这些框架内置了多种安全机制。
配置安全头
在VPS 150芯动版中,可以配置安全头来限制扫描的范围和频率,使用nmap
的高级选项,设置扫描的端口范围和扫描速度,防止不必要的扫描。
防火墙规则
根据业务需求,合理配置防火墙规则,仅允许必要的服务和端口连接,可以配置iptables
规则,允许HTTP/HTTPS、SSH、FTP等服务,同时阻止其他非必要的流量。
安全测试
定期进行安全测试,可以发现潜在的安全漏洞,可以使用OWASP ZAP
或Burp Suite
等工具进行安全扫描,及时修复发现的问题。
VPS 150芯动版作为高性能的VPS服务器,其安全性不容忽视,通过合理的配置和优化,可以有效防范各种安全威胁和攻击,建议用户:
- 定期更新软件和系统内核。
- 合理配置防火墙规则,仅允许必要的服务。
- 使用经过签名的Web框架和安全的软件包。
- 定期进行安全测试,发现并修复潜在问题。
- 保持系统的日志记录,便于后续的故障排查和安全分析。
通过以上措施,可以确保VPS 150芯动版的安全性,为企业的业务提供有力的保障。
卡尔云官网
www.kaeryun.com